Hi: in my version of Acrobat Reader (Version 11.0.23 on a 2016 macbook) there is no option to choose "open in separate windows" in the General tab of Acrobat Preferences as other people have posted. HOWEVER, the following trick worked for me:
Go to "System Preferences" on the mac, and then "Dock". To the right of "Prefer tabs when opening documents" select "In Full Screen Only." Good luck, this caused me hours of frustration but was finally fixed by this trick.
